WIEAND, Judge: Joseph P. Fitzgerald, Jr. was shot six times by Jack McCutcheon, his neighbor and an off-duty policeman. Fitzgerald instituted an action in trespass against McCutcheon, the City of Philadelphia, and the Robert H. Foerderer Republican Club and recovered a verdict against McCutcheon and the City of Philadelphia. 1…
